The Deterioration of Materials Over Time
Salt corrosion is one of the biggest challenges for coastal homes. Once paint begins to fade, peel, or crack, saltwater particles settle on exposed surfaces and accelerate wear. Timber starts to swell and decay, metal components rust, and concrete may form hairline fractures. These minor issues can quickly grow into major repairs if ignored. Repainting every few years with high-quality, weather-resistant paint creates a waterproof and UV-protected barrier. This coating locks out moisture and sun damage, helping your home maintain its strength, durability, and polished finish year-round.
The Risk of Mold and Mildew Growth
Moisture trapped beneath worn or peeling paint provides the perfect environment for mold and mildew to grow. In Dee Why’s humid conditions, these patches can spread fast, leaving dark stains and affecting indoor air quality. Regular repainting seals the exterior and prevents moisture from entering, cutting off the source of growth. Choosing paint with built-in anti-mildew or anti-fungal agents offers even stronger protection.
